Transcatheter Embolization And Occlusion Devices Market Key Growth Drivers and Demand Factors
The transcatheter embolization and occlusion devices market was valued at approximately USD 3.5 billion in 2024 and is expected to grow to USD 9.6 billion by 2033, at a compound annual growth rate (CAGR) of 10.4% from 2025 to 2033.
The transcatheter embolization and occlusion devices market is being driven by a convergence of epidemiological, clinical, and technological forces that are collectively reinforcing procedure volume growth and device adoption across multiple therapeutic indications globally. The rising global burden of hepatocellular carcinoma, renal cell carcinoma, uterine fibroids, arteriovenous malformations, and gastrointestinal hemorrhage is generating sustained and growing clinical demand for embolization and occlusion procedures – with catheter-based approaches consistently demonstrating favorable outcomes relative to open surgery in terms of complications, recovery duration, and healthcare resource utilization.
Technology advancement is a defining growth catalyst within the transcatheter embolization and occlusion devices market growth analysis. Next-generation embolic agents including drug-eluting microspheres, bioabsorbable particles, and liquid embolic systems are expanding the therapeutic application range and improving procedural precision in complex vascular anatomies. Coil platform innovations featuring three-dimensional configurations, stretch-resistant detachment mechanisms, and hydrogel-coating technologies are elevating occlusion reliability in both neurovascular and peripheral vascular applications. The integration of real-time imaging guidance systems and cone-beam CT with embolization procedures is further improving targeting accuracy and reducing radiation exposure – raising the procedural standard across the transcatheter embolization and occlusion devices market competitive landscape.

Transcatheter Embolization And Occlusion Devices Market Challenges, Risks, and Barriers
Despite its robust growth outlook, the transcatheter embolization and occlusion devices market faces a set of meaningful structural and operational challenges that require careful navigation. Stringent regulatory approval processes across the United States, European Union, and Asia-Pacific markets extend product development timelines and increase commercialization costs for device manufacturers. Reimbursement variability across healthcare systems creates uneven adoption rates and commercial return unpredictability in certain geographies. Procedural complexity requires highly specialized interventional training, limiting the rate at which new clinical centers can adopt advanced embolization techniques within the transcatheter embolization and occlusion devices market. Supply chain dependencies for precision-engineered microcatheter components and biocompatible embolic materials introduce procurement risk. Additionally, post-market surveillance obligations and adverse event reporting requirements impose ongoing compliance burdens for manufacturers operating across multiple international jurisdictions within the transcatheter embolization and occlusion devices market.

Transcatheter Embolization And Occlusion Devices Market Regional Performance & Geographic Expansion
North America dominates the transcatheter embolization and occlusion devices market, anchored by a highly developed interventional radiology infrastructure, favorable reimbursement frameworks, and a concentrated base of leading device manufacturers and academic research institutions. Europe represents the second-largest regional market, with Germany, France, the United Kingdom, and Italy driving adoption through sophisticated hospital procurement systems and active clinical research ecosystems. Asia-Pacific is the fastest-growing region within the transcatheter embolization and occlusion devices market, propelled by healthcare infrastructure expansion, rising cancer prevalence, and growing minimally invasive procedure adoption in China, Japan, India, and South Korea. Latin America is developing steadily, with Brazil and Mexico emerging as key secondary markets. The Middle East & Africa region is gaining momentum through healthcare modernization investment and expanding interventional specialty capacity.

Sustainability & Regulatory Outlook
Sustainability considerations are increasingly influencing product development priorities and procurement decisions within the transcatheter embolization and occlusion devices market, as hospital systems, group purchasing organizations, and regulatory bodies place greater emphasis on the environmental and social dimensions of medical device manufacturing and lifecycle management. Leading manufacturers are investing in reduced-packaging initiatives, recyclable device tray systems, and manufacturing process optimization programs that lower carbon emissions and chemical waste associated with precision medical device production. Single-use device design – already the standard within the transcatheter embolization and occlusion devices market for infection control reasons – is being scrutinized for its environmental footprint, prompting innovation in biocompatible and biodegradable material substitution where clinically appropriate.
The regulatory landscape shaping the transcatheter embolization and occlusion devices market is both rigorous and rapidly evolving across all major geographies. In the United States, the FDA’s 510(k) and PMA pathways govern market entry for embolization and occlusion device classes, with the agency placing increasing emphasis on clinical evidence quality, real-world performance data, and post-market surveillance program robustness. The EU Medical Device Regulation has substantially raised clinical evidence, unique device identification, and post-market clinical follow-up requirements for transcatheter embolization and occlusion devices market participants seeking CE marking – creating meaningful compliance investment requirements that are simultaneously raising market entry barriers and rewarding manufacturers with strong clinical documentation capabilities. In Asia-Pacific, Japan’s PMDA, China’s NMPA, and South Korea’s MFDS each maintain distinct regulatory frameworks with varying clinical data localization requirements that manufacturers must navigate carefully to access these high-growth markets.
